A farmer in Gaoua, Noël KAMBOU has been suffering from lymphatic filariasis for more than 25 years. This disease is a real burden, which hinders his agricultural activities. “When I fall and my foot hurts, I can lie down for twenty days without leaving my room. So I can no longer farm,” says Noël. Before this illness, he was able to produce enough for his family and for other needs.

Despite these difficulties, he is still determined to fight his way through. “I am a father, I have children, I have to take care of their needs. That’s why I get up, I manage to get my farm work in order to help the family,” he says.
